Apptronik is a human-centered robotics company developing AI-powered robots to support humanity in every facet of life. Our flagship humanoid robot, Apollo, is built to collaborate thoughtfully with people, starting with critical industries such as manufacturing and logistics, with future applications in healthcare, the home, and beyond.

We operate at the cutting edge of Applied AI, applying our expertise across the full robotics stack to solve some of society's most important problems. You will join a team dedicated to bringing Apollo to market at scale, tackling the complex challenges like safety, commercialization, and mass production to change the world for the better.

About Apptronik

Apptronik is building Apollo, a general-purpose humanoid robot designed for manufacturing, logistics, and everyday tasks. Spun out of the Human Centered Robotics Lab at UT Austin, they have collaborated with NASA, the US Air Force, and leading defense contractors.
